Probable Cause
The inadequate inspection of the carburetor by the aircraft mechanic who had recently worked on the carburetor, which failed to detect a cracked float, resulting in a total loss of engine power during cruise flight. A factor associated with the accident was the lack of suitable terrain for a forced landing.
